  4. I'll toss the 2 cents into the pot... Be aware that AirDog and FASS are the same design for the most part but the FASS is phyiscally larger and difficult to hide under a truck. As for the platinum series I'm not sure... As for a AirDog it hides behind the transfer case quite well... So consider the phyiscal size of the pump, filters, and your mounting location.

  6. Just going from 55 MPH to 65 MPH your wind drag will nearly double but going from 55 MPH to 75 MPH the wind drage will nearly be 4 times... Speed is not your friend... This is just a truck alone... Tyipcal drag co. is about .46 to .48 but now the graph doesn't include trailer of larger frontal area but you can imagine the curve gets more aggressive with a larger frontal profile and more speed.

  17. Umm... learn curve for Edge Comp boxes... The quick answer is 1x1 is going to give you the least boost of MPG over 5x5 will give you the most... You main level is how much timing curve you going to get with the maximum amount of fuel. So for the most timing you need the main level set to 5. So 1 being the least amount of timing and 5 being the most. Now as for sub level... Sublevel is how fast you get to full fuel and timing in relationship to boost. 1. 33% of stock fuel and timing till 20 PSI 2. 50% of stock fuel and timing till 15 PSI 3. 67% of stock fuel and timing till 10 PSI 4. Some extra fuel and timing at 0 PSI 5. Full fuel and timing at 0 PSI So if you looking for the most amount of timing keep it on 5x5 and use a light foot... Another tip is as the boost rises above 5 PSI the timing starts to retard. This princepal is from the autoignition temperature. http://en.wikipedia.org/wiki/Autoignition_temperature The autoignition temperature or kindling point of a substance is the lowest temperature at which it will spontaneously ignite in a normal atmosphere without an external source of ignition, such as a flame or spark. This temperature is required to supply the activation energy needed for combustion. The temperature at which a chemical will ignite decreases as the pressure increases (Boost pressure) or oxygen concentration increases. It is usually applied to a combustible fuel mixture. So to keep timing correct the VP44 is going to retard slighly to keep from over advancing the timing... Take notice the timing it more advanced at low boost pressures compared to high boost. So running the Edge Comp on 5x5 with a light foot and low boost pressures you can increase that stock table higher...

  22. I've come across several bad caps missing the spring on the vacuum valve of the cap. As you would hold the cap in normally mounted position the valve would hang down and not close causing the radiator not to hold pressure. I've seen where upper rubber seals in the cap start to get little crakcs in them causing air to leak in. Worse yet seen radiator cap missing them out right.. Damaged radiator necks it possible cracked, deformed, or just damaged it will not seal correctly and draw from the bottle. How is the hose to the bottle is the hose damaged? Is the bottle damaged on the draw tube if its it will spit coolant into the bottle be never draw it back up... See this one too...
